In the world of SciFi Horror and Adventure, we’ve got a new story to dive into. ‘The Last Boy on Earth’ is set to release on November 7, 2023. If you’re a fan of digital releases, you’re in luck – it’ll be available on Digital and VOD.
Nicolás Onetti takes the director’s chair for this film, while the story springs from the imaginative mind of Camilo Zaffora. Producing such a thrilling tale isn’t easy, and the credit goes to Carlos Goitia. These names promise us a film that’s going to be the talk of the town.
We’re getting a mix of actors, some familiar and others who might be new to you. The cast boasts names like Sam Hoare, Joshua Grothe, Arben Bajraktaraj, and John Bubniak. Every actor brings a unique touch, making the film’s anticipation even more electric.

Stars: Magui Bravi, Agustin Olcese, Clara Kovacic, Maria Eugenia Rigon, Matías Desiderio, Juan Pablo Bishel, Germán Baudino, Chucho Fernández, Mario Alarcón, David Michigan | Written by Camilo Zaffora | Directed by Nicolás Onetti
Following his 2017 film, What The Waters Left Behind, director Nicolás Onetti crafts a further tale of the cannibalistic family living within the flooded town of Epecuén. The focus is on an Anglo-American rock band on the last stop of their unlucky tour, where the members’ frustrations are spilling out into explosive arguments. Approaching them after the performance is the mysterious Carla (Magui Bravi), whose offer of a place to stay leads the band into a hellish scenario.
